The twisting in a twisted pair cable helps make the cable immune to electromagnetic interference. These cables are of two types: Shielded and unshielded twisted pair.

It provides some "shielding" to minimize coupling between signals in a cable, reducing crosstalk and other forms of interference. It is cheaper than the complete shielding provided by coaxial cable, when coaxial cable would be overkill for the problem.

Disconnect speedometer cable from back of speedometer gauge by twisting the threaded collar to unscrew. Then just slide the old cable out of cable housing and insert new one. If cable is broken you may need to disconnect cable from transmission tail shaft to remove part of the cable. Cable must be inserted into the gauge end of the cable housing.
